Aletheia Therapy is a mental health practice in Plano offering individual, couples, family, and group therapy, plus telehealth sessions. Their diverse team of licensed therapists specializes in trauma, anxiety, depression, personality disorders, PTSD, LGBTQIA+ issues, racial identity, neurodivergent support, and abuse recovery. They emphasize relational psychodynamic therapy combined with CBT, DBT, and person-centered approaches, with flexible pricing starting at $50/session to make quality care accessible.
Ideal for: Individuals seeking long-term therapy, couples working on intimacy and trust, families restructuring relationships, LGBTQIA+ and AAPI communities, trauma and abuse survivors, people with personality disorders
Service area: Plano, TX and surrounding Dallas-Fort Worth area
Diverse Specializations: Therapists trained to work with personality disorders, trauma, PTSD, AAPI experiences, LGBTQIA+ clients, neurodivergent individuals, and abuse recovery — addressing complexities beyond common anxiety and depression.
Flexible Therapy Modalities: While rooted in relational psychodynamic therapy, the team tailors treatment using CBT, DBT, and person-centered approaches to match each client's unique needs.
Accessible Pricing: Sessions range from $50–$150 depending on clinician level, with free 15-minute consultations to help clients find the right therapist fit without financial barriers.
